FREDERICKTOWN – Lois Ann Fletcher, 70, of Fredericktown, passed away on Jan. 2, 2021, at The Ohio State University Hospital. She was born on Feb. 24, 1950, in Mount Vernon, to Kenneth and Betty (Poling) McFarland.
Lois enjoyed time spent with her family, watching her grandchildren's sports and shows, gardening, traveling and sightseeing.
She is survived by her husband, Jeffrey Fletcher, whom she married on July 23, 1969; her children, Eric Fletcher of Hillsboro, Oregon, Travis (Kim) Fletcher of Howard, Shawn (Jackie) Fletcher of Fredericktown, Amy (Mike) Patterson of Fredericktown and Ty (Melissa) Fletcher of Fredericktown; grandchildren, Kayla, Tina (Austin), Jeremy (Jessyca), Anna, Lydia, Nate, John and Shannon; great-grandchildren, Hannah and expected great-grandson Colton; and her siblings, Patricia (Larry) Frost of Mount Vernon, Charles (Patricia Ann) McFarland of Butler and Daniel (Sharon) McFarland of Butler.
Friends may call at the Lasater Funeral Home on Wednesday from 5-7 p.m., where the funeral service will be held on Thursday at 10:30 a.m. with Mr. Gary Stevens officiating. Burial will follow in Mount Vernon Memorial Gardens.
The family suggests memorial contributions to be made in Lois' memory to the OSU Transplant Clinic.
